The state of Sikkim has inaugurated the SOTTO Office to enhance its organ and tissue transplantation infrastructure, aiming to improve donor coordination and patient access.

Sikkim's health department announced the creation of a dedicated SOTTO (State Organ and Tissue Transplantation Office) to streamline organ and tissue donation processes across the state. The new office will serve as a central hub for donor registration, tissue banking, and coordination with hospitals and transplant centers.

Officials said the initiative is part of a broader effort to address the shortage of available organs and to ensure that patients requiring transplants receive timely medical attention. By consolidating data and standardising protocols, SOTTO aims to increase the success rate of transplant surgeries.

The establishment of the office also includes plans for public awareness campaigns, training programs for medical staff, and partnerships with national transplant networks. The move reflects Sikkim's commitment to strengthening its healthcare infrastructure and aligning with national health objectives.

The SOTTO Office is expected to become operational within the next few weeks, with the health ministry monitoring its impact on donor rates and transplant outcomes.
